Judson A. Hiscutt, 85, of Richmond [Minnesota], formerly of New Port Richey, FL, died Friday, January 18, 2019, at Cherrywood Senior Living in Richmond. His funeral service will be 2:30 pm Wednesday, January 23, 2019, at the Johnson Funeral Home in Paynesville. A visitation will be held from 2-2:30 pm on Wednesday before the service.

Judson Alvin Hiscutt was born February 6, 1933, in Columbia City, IN, the son of Joey and Edith (Gilbert) Hiscutt. He received his education in Columbia City. After High School Judd enlisted in the United States Air Force. Where he served his county for 26 years before retiring.

On May 22, 1955, Judd was united in marriage to Dorothy Gruver in Columbia City, IN. This union was blessed with two daughters and a son. The family made their home in New Port Richey, FL.

After serving in the Air Force Judd owned and operated an appliance repair business. He then went back to school where he earned his Associate Degree in Human Services from Pasco-Hernando Community College. Judd then became a social worker for the State of Florida.

When Dorothy became ill Judd retired and became her full-time caregiver. In 2008 Dorothy died. They shared in 53 years before Dorothy's death. In 2014 Judd moved to Minnesota to be closer to his daughter.

Judd loved the outdoors. You could often find him sitting in a lawn chair just enjoying the sunshine, walking along nature trails or riding his motorcycle. Judd was a wonderful husband and father, he loved spending time with his family especially his grandchildren.

Judson A. Hiscutt died on January 18, 2019, at the age of 85. He is survived by his daughters, Stacy (Mark) Hayden of Las Vegas, NV, and Kelly (Jim) Pritchett, of Paynesville, MN, and many grandchildren and great-grandchildren.

Judd was preceded in death by his wife Dorothy; son, Zack; three brothers; and three sisters.

NOTE: Will be buried in Florida National Cemetery, Section 605, next to his wife Dorothy H. Gruver Hiscutt in Bushnell, Florida.
